The primary objective of underwater image enhancement is to recover the quality that has been degraded due to scatters and amalgamation within the underwater environment. These images suffer from strong absorption, low contrast, noise, and poor visibility. Thus to avoid aforementioned problems of the underwater images, enhancement is required. This paper discusses various image enhancement techniques like histogram equalization, Adaptive Histogram Equalization(AHE), CLAIM, histogram slicing, Contrast stretching, Dark Channel Prior, etc.
